[resolved] transactions management

Hi,
I'd like to know how Talend manages transactions (commit, rollback)
If I consider a very simple job with a flat file in input whom I want to load in a table.
Is it possible to insert records of flat file without automatically committing ? And just commit if a make an explicit commit ?

Talend provides the same way you would code manually. You can create a connection and use this connection in any database components and decide where you place a commit and rollback component. Nearly for every database you find connections, commit and rollback components.
